My Sorrows Poem by Amanda Shelton

My Sorrows



There are times when I would love to drowned in my sorrows
have it all fade for just a moment
have it leave for just a moment
even if I have to find my way after being lost
for so long in my sea of sorrows
having them decay and die right in front of me
seeing for my self that it wasn't really me
that it was my sorrow coming to take me
where I need not be
where I do not want to be
I come to my self in the end
knowing that the sobering moment will be a painful one
but yet it has to be for we all have to wake in the end
and start a new day and do it all over again
it is the sickle we live in
